Designing model testing protocols for multi-task systems to ensure consistent performance across varied use cases.
This evergreen guide outlines practical testing frameworks for multi-task AI systems, emphasizing robust evaluation across diverse tasks, data distributions, and real-world constraints to sustain reliable performance over time.
August 07, 2025
Facebook X Reddit
Designing effective testing protocols for multi-task AI systems requires a disciplined approach that accounts for task heterogeneity, distribution shifts, and user-facing variability. Start with a clear model specification, enumerating all supported tasks, inputs, outputs, and latency targets. Next, establish a standardized evaluation suite that mirrors real-world use cases, including edge cases and rare scenarios. Incorporate statistical guardrails, such as confidence intervals and power analyses, to quantify uncertainty in measurements. Ensure measurement pipelines are reproducible, with versioned datasets and controlled random seeds. Finally, institutionalize feedback loops from deployment to testing, enabling rapid diagnosis and iteration whenever a task's performance drifts or regresses under novel conditions.
A robust testing framework for multi-task models must balance breadth and depth. It should cover core tasks, supplementary tasks that resemble transfer learning opportunities, and adversarial scenarios that probe robustness. Define baseline metrics for each task, but also integrate cross-task aggregates that reveal interactions and competition for shared resources. Include latency, throughput, and energy considerations alongside accuracy and calibration. Create a sandboxed evaluation environment that isolates external influences, yet can simulate production workloads with realistic concurrency patterns. Document failure modes systematically, so engineers can pinpoint whether breakdowns arise from data quality, model capacity, or system infrastructure. Regularly run end-to-end tests that reflect user journeys across multiple tasks in a single session.
Structured experiments illuminate where cross-task interactions emerge.
In practice, begin by mapping the task graph and identifying where cross-task interference might occur. This awareness informs dataset construction, ensuring diverse representations of each task’s input space. Curate test sets to expose both common and unusual combinations of tasks, noting how outputs may be affected when multiple objectives compete for shared model parameters. Establish baseline reactivity checks that monitor how small input perturbations propagate through the system, revealing sensitivity patterns. Maintain a living test catalog that evolves with model updates, new data sources, and adjustments to training objectives. This proactive approach helps sustain performance even as operational contexts shift over time.
ADVERTISEMENT
ADVERTISEMENT
A key consideration is measurement fidelity. Use aligned evaluation protocols so that metrics are comparable across tasks and deployments. Predefine success criteria per task, including acceptable ranges for calibration error and uncertainty. Implement stratified sampling to ensure minority groups or rare subtypes receive adequate scrutiny. Build dashboards that visualize per-task trajectories and joint metrics, enabling rapid detection of diverging trends. Pair automated scoring with human-in-the-loop review for complex judgments or where downstream impact depends on nuanced interpretation. Finally, standardize reporting formats so stakeholders can assess health at a glance and responsibly steer product decisions.
Calibration and fairness checks are integral to multi-task testing.
Experiment design must reflect the real-world sequencing of tasks. Plan multi-step scenarios where the model processes several tasks in a single session, observing how context from earlier steps influences later judgments. Use counterfactual testing to estimate what would happen if a task were omitted or replaced, helping identify dependencies and potential brittleness. Incorporate drip tests that gradually increase input difficulty or data noise, tracking how resilience evolves with additional perturbations. Maintain a log of experiment conditions, including hyperparameters and dataset versions, so results remain attributable and comparable across iterations. This discipline reduces ambiguity when interpreting fluctuations and guides responsible improvements.
ADVERTISEMENT
ADVERTISEMENT
Another vital component is governance around data freshness. Multi-task systems benefit from diverse, up-to-date data, but stale inputs risk degraded performance. Schedule regular refreshes of training and evaluation data, with clear procedures for validating new samples before they enter pipelines. Track distributional shifts using measures like population drift and concept drift, enabling timely recalibration or retraining. Establishments of thresholds trigger maintenance windows where experiments are rerun to confirm stability prior to production releases. Ensure data provenance and privacy controls remain intact throughout every cycle, preserving user trust while expanding the model’s practical applicability.
End-to-end operational checks guarantee practical stability.
Calibration across tasks demands careful alignment of probability estimates with observed outcomes. Implement task-specific calibration models when needed, but guard against overfitting by cross-validating across independent folds. Use reliability diagrams and expected calibration error to quantify alignment, then address miscalibration with post-processing techniques appropriate for each task’s context. Fairness considerations require audits across demographic groups and usage cohorts, ensuring no task disproportionately benefits or harms any user segment. Document any observed disparities, investigate root causes, and design mitigation strategies that preserve overall performance while reducing disparate impact. Regularly publish transparency reports to demonstrate accountability to customers and regulators.
Beyond technical fidelity, system reliability hinges on robust deployment practices. Containerized components, feature flags, and canary releases enable gradual exposure to new protocols without risking global degradation. Establish rollback plans and automated anomaly detection to curtail issues before they affect users. Monitor end-to-end latency budgets under realistic traffic patterns, including bursts and concurrent sessions that stress the scheduler. Institute incident response playbooks that clearly assign responsibilities, with runbooks for common failure modes observed during multi-task operation. Finally, align performance objectives with business goals, ensuring that improvements in one task do not come at the expense of others or of user experience.
ADVERTISEMENT
ADVERTISEMENT
Documentation and governance frame continuous improvement.
Internal reproducibility is foundational for trustworthy testing. Use fixed seeds and controlled environments to minimize variability across experiments, while still capturing genuine performance signals. Version-control all components, including preprocessing pipelines, feature engineering steps, and model wrappers. Maintain a centralized registry of experiment configurations so teams can retrieve, reproduce, or extend prior work. Regularly audit dependencies and third-party libraries for compatibility and security. Encourage cross-team replication studies where independent groups try to reproduce key findings, reinforcing confidence in reported results. This cultural practice reduces the likelihood of hidden biases and strengthens collaborative problem-solving when debugging multi-task behavior.
User-centric evaluation elevates the relevance of testing outcomes. Gather qualitative feedback from real users and operators about perceived usefulness, reliability, and consistency across tasks. Translate such feedback into measurable signals that can be tracked alongside quantitative metrics. Include scenario-based testing that emulates actual user journeys, capturing how the system performs with varying intent and context. Use synthetic data sparingly to stress rare cases, but preserve realism to avoid masking practical issues. Integrate continuous learning pipelines where permitted, ensuring that ongoing updates preserve prior strengths while addressing newly observed weaknesses in multi-task performance.
Comprehensive documentation anchors long-term success. Describe testing methodologies, metric definitions, and evaluation workflows in a living document accessible to engineers, product managers, and stakeholders. Capture decision rationales for test designs and the rationale behind chosen thresholds, enabling future teams to understand trade-offs. Establish a clear governance model with roles and accountability for test maintenance, data stewardship, and release readiness. Include guidance on how to interpret failed tests, when to halt deployments, and how to communicate risks to customers. Transparent reporting builds trust and accelerates learning across the organization.
In summary, designing model testing protocols for multi-task systems is an ongoing discipline. It blends rigorous measurement, thoughtful experiment design, and disciplined governance to sustain dependable performance across diverse use cases. By formalizing task mappings, calibration strategies, data freshness practices, and deployment safeguards, teams can mitigate drift and uncertainty. The result is a resilient testing culture that protects user experience while enabling responsible growth. As multi-task systems continue to evolve, the emphasis remains on verifiable evidence, clear communication, and perpetual iteration to achieve steady, trustworthy outcomes.
Related Articles
This evergreen guide explains how to build and document reproducible assessments of preprocessing pipelines, focusing on stability, reproducibility, and practical steps that researchers and engineers can consistently apply across projects.
A practical guide to building durable, scalable knowledge bases that capture failed experiments, key insights, and repeatable methods across teams, with governance, tooling, and cultural alignment powering continuous improvement.
A practical, evergreen guide to designing structured human-in-the-loop evaluation protocols that extract meaningful qualitative feedback, drive iterative model improvements, and align system behavior with user expectations over time.
A practical, forward-looking exploration of how optimization-based data selection can systematically assemble training sets that maximize validation gains while minimizing per-label costs, with enduring implications for scalable model development.
In modern AI workflows, balancing compute costs with performance requires a disciplined framework that evaluates configurations under budget limits, quantifying trade-offs, and selecting models that maximize value per dollar while meeting reliability and latency targets. This article outlines a practical approach to principled optimization that respects budgetary constraints, guiding teams toward configurations that deliver superior cost-adjusted metrics without compromising essential quality standards.
August 05, 2025
Crafting reproducible pipelines for energy accounting in AI demands disciplined tooling, transparent methodologies, and scalable measurements that endure changes in hardware, software stacks, and workloads across research projects.
This evergreen guide explains pragmatic early stopping heuristics, balancing overfitting avoidance with efficient use of computational resources, while outlining actionable strategies and robust verification to sustain performance over time.
August 07, 2025
This evergreen guide outlines practical strategies to evaluate how machine learning models withstand real-world distribution shifts, emphasizing deployment-grounded metrics, adversarial scenarios, and scalable, repeatable assessment pipelines.
August 11, 2025
This evergreen guide outlines a practical, reproducible approach to prioritizing retraining tasks by translating monitored degradation signals into concrete, auditable workflows, enabling teams to respond quickly while preserving traceability and stability.
Robust validation of augmented data is essential for preserving real-world generalization; this article outlines practical, evergreen practices for assessing synthetic transforms while avoiding artifacts that could mislead models.
August 10, 2025
This evergreen article examines designing durable, scalable pipelines that blend simulation, model training, and rigorous real-world validation, ensuring reproducibility, traceability, and governance across complex data workflows.
August 04, 2025
This evergreen guide examines how optimizers and hyperparameters should evolve as models scale, outlining practical strategies for accuracy, speed, stability, and resource efficiency across tiny, mid-sized, and colossal architectures.
August 06, 2025
Robust, repeatable approaches enable researchers to simulate bot-like pressures, uncover hidden weaknesses, and reinforce model resilience through standardized, transparent testing workflows over time.
A practical guide to building stable, repeatable evaluation environments for multi-model decision chains, emphasizing shared benchmarks, deterministic runs, versioned data, and transparent metrics to foster trust and scientific progress.
A durable, transparent evaluation framework must capture hierarchical structure, variable dependencies, and output composition, ensuring reproducible comparisons across models and datasets while reflecting real-world task complexity and uncertainty.
This evergreen guide outlines rigorous, reproducible practices for auditing model sensitivity, explaining how to detect influential features, verify results, and implement effective mitigation strategies across diverse data environments.
In dynamic environments, automated root-cause analysis tools must quickly identify unexpected metric divergences that follow system changes, integrating data across pipelines, experiments, and deployment histories to guide rapid corrective actions and maintain decision confidence.
This article outlines durable, scalable strategies to simulate adversarial user prompts and measure model responses, focusing on reproducibility, rigorous testing environments, clear acceptance criteria, and continuous improvement loops for safety.
This evergreen guide explains how researchers and practitioners can design repeatable experiments to detect gradual shifts in user tastes, quantify their impact, and recalibrate recommendation systems without compromising stability or fairness over time.
This evergreen guide examines principled active sampling approaches, balancing representativeness, cost, and labeling constraints to construct robust training sets that generalize across diverse data distributions and real-world scenarios.